RE: The Big Bang theory???????????

The way I understood the model(I have no background in physics)was that the Big Bang occurred after the singularity reached critical mass. This was the result of a contraction process caused by gravity. Hawking posits that there wasn't one 'Big Bang', but a series of them. In his model the universe expands and the material at the edge (e.g. Quasars) is the oldest matter post Big Bang. The expansion of the material universe slows to a point where gravity counters the expansionary force and contraction begins. This contraction ultimately arrives at the starting point and another explosion occurs. Nowhere do I recall that matter didn't exist at all, just in a different form.

Please correct me if I misunderstand this, for it has been some years since I read up on the subject.
